Precisely what is Yuca? Understanding the basis Vegetable
Yuca, also called cassava, can be a starchy root vegetable that plays an important position in many meal plans world wide. Its heritage traces back to South The us, wherever it had been cultivated around five,000 several years in the past.
Currently, yuca types incorporate sweet and bitter forms, Every single with unique culinary works by using. Sweet yuca is usually liked boiled or fried, while bitter yuca involves processing to eliminate toxins. Being familiar with the variances among these types enables you to enjoy their various purposes in different cuisines.
Yuca's adaptability has made it a staple in African, Asian, and Latin American eating plans, showcasing its worth in world foods programs. By Discovering yuca's background and types, you unlock its potential for modern culinary works by using in your individual kitchen area.

How to organize Yuca for Cooking
To prepare yuca for cooking, get started by choosing organization, unblemished roots, as good quality greatly influences the final dish.
Upcoming, wash the yuca comprehensively to eliminate any Filth.
For productive yuca peeling strategies, make use of a vegetable peeler or a sharp knife, thoroughly taking away the thick, waxy pores and skin to expose the white flesh beneath.
Be conscious in the fibrous Main; it’s important to discard any woody sections.
Following peeling, Slash the yuca into uniform pieces, ensuring even cooking.
You'll be able to select various yuca preparing strategies, for example boiling, frying, or steaming, dependant upon your required final result.

Freezing Yuca: Very best Methods
Freezing yuca is often a great way to preserve its freshness and lengthen its shelf African food store near me life, but performing it effectively is crucial to keep up its texture and taste.
Start by peeling and reducing the yuca into manageable parts, then blanch them in boiling drinking water for around 5 minutes. This fast blanching can help deactivate enzymes that could affect high-quality through freezing.
Just after blanching, plunge the pieces into ice h2o to stop the cooking procedure. Pat them dry and bundle them in airtight baggage, getting rid of extra air to circumvent freezer burn up.
Label your luggage Using the day for simple tracking. By using these freezing procedures, you can guarantee productive yuca preservation, Prepared to be used in your favorite recipes anytime.

The Environmental Affect of Yuca Farming
Whilst lots of value yuca for its culinary Added benefits, its environmental effects deserves thorough thought.
Yuca farming features substantial environmental Added benefits when practiced sustainably. By utilizing crop rotation and intercropping approaches, you'll be able to enhance soil fertility and reduce the want for chemical fertilizers. This promotes biodiversity and stops soil erosion.
Also, yuca's capacity to thrive in bad soils and tolerate drought can make it a resilient crop inside the deal with of local weather alter. You’ll also learn that yuca demands a lot less drinking water in comparison to other staple crops, which often can aid conserve water sources in farming communities.
